sc386 = an error with the black developer. This could be caused by something in the DV unit itself, or the black toner. If you've just replaced either one of these recently, try reinstalling them and resetting the machine. Otherwise, the black development unit probably needs to be replaced.
Book says:
1. Turn the main switch off and on.
2. Reset the transfer belt unit.
3. Clean or replace the transfer belt
sensor.
4. Replace the transfer belt contact
motor.
5. Check the contact and release
mechanism of the transfer belt unit.
My guess is cleaning will solve it.
open the front door and sing don the green lever
locate the 2 screws at the top and bottom of the unit and remove them.
remove the cleaning unit 1 screw and a thmb lever slide the unit out (its on rails) wipevacum and/or blow clean the unit and re assemble
also clean the connector that it plugs to in the back of the machine
(q-tip)
if it still appears belt or unit will need to be replaced
sc440 on the CL7000 is a drum motor error. sc440-2 is specific to the color drum motor. The problem is either the motor itself, the drum gear position sensor, or one or more of the color photoconductor units. The photoconductor units you can replace yourself if you have extras -- see if that will clear up the problem.
If they don't, you'll need to contact a service technician to inspect (and replace if need be) the motor and sensor.

probably only when printing in colour? Black only, is ok right? It needs to have it's line adjustment procedure done. This is a series of complicated trial and error adjustments performed in service mode that the individual colours are adjusted based on printouts generated by the printer. Can only be adjusted by a service tech with experience with this adjustment.
